Biography

Tina Barrett (born 16 September 1976) is a London based singer-songwriter, originally trained as a ballerina at the Arts Educational Performing Arts School.

Her major breakthrough came in 1999, when she became a member of S Club 7 where she enjoyed four years of hit singles, arena tours and awards, including two Brit Awards. Barrett gained a generation of fans and help sell over 13 million records.

Barrett is rumoured to be working on the production of a solo album to include the tracks "Moon Child" and "Love Crime". Tina's debut will be released in the Autumn. Her sister, Abby, was a member of the short lived girl group Madasun in 2000.

In 2003, Barrett landed a $400,000 (around £250,000) worldwide advertising contract with Wrigley's chewing gum.

In 2004, she was rumoured internationally to be romantically linked to David Schwimmer for a few months following media reports of her visiting him at his Spanish villa.

Tina recorded a cover for Rod Stewart's hit song Da Ya Think I'm Sexy?.
